from ... import (
controldir,
static_tuple,
)
from ...commands import (
Command,
)
class cmd_chk_used_by(Command):
__doc__ = \
"""Find the inventories/revisions that reference a CHK."""
hidden = True
takes_args = ['key*']
takes_options = ['directory']
def run(self, key_list, directory=u'.'):
key_list = [static_tuple.StaticTuple(k) for k in key_list]
if len(key_list) > 1:
key_list = frozenset(key_list)
bd, relpath = controldir.ControlDir.open_containing(directory)
repo = bd.find_repository()
self.add_cleanup(repo.lock_read().unlock)
inv_vf = repo.inventories
all_invs = [k[-1] for k in inv_vf.keys()]
# print len(all_invs)
for inv in repo.iter_inventories(all_invs):
if inv.id_to_entry.key() in key_list:
self.outf.write(
'id_to_entry of %s -> %s\n' %
(inv.revision_id, inv.id_to_entry.key(),))
if inv.parent_id_basename_to_file_id.key() in key_list:
self.outf.write(
'parent_id_basename_to_file_id of %s -> %s\n' %
(inv.revision_id, inv.parent_id_basename_to_file_id.key(),))
